How UX Designers are using AI in their Workflow?
The latest industry data shows that 75% of AI use in UX is for text tasks such as writing docs and summarizing notes, not for complicated visual work. They sometimes use AI tools for brainstorming design ideas but do not produce navigation structure or complete user workflow.
If you use AI to fast-track messy research synthesis, you can miss out on the reliability of the product needed to map out functional user navigation.
A 2026 survey of 1,478 designers by the State of Prototyping report found that the most-used design tool after Figma is now an AI product. 50.8% of designers said they use AI tools every week, while 37.7% reported using zero AI tools at all. The profession is splitting into two groups: those getting faster with AI assistance and those who haven’t started yet.
Phase 1- Examples of AI tools for UX research and synthesis
The real value of AI lies in cutting down the time spent on research work. It help organize raw user feedback, write documentation, and tag user patterns by hand.
ChatGPT

For example, designers often use ChatGPT to extract the top three user complaints from a batch of interview notes. It handles the heavy research synthesis work so the team can get straight to the actual design strategy.
It’s also useful for generating first-draft interview scripts, writing screener questions, and turning a list of findings into a structured presentation deck outline. Pricing: Free plan available. ChatGPT Plus: $20/month. ChatGPT Team: $25/user/month.
What it doesn’t do well: Anything requiring visual output or design judgment. Don’t ask it to wireframe. Also, be careful with direct quotes from user research. It sometimes synthesizes in ways that subtly shift the meaning of what a user said.
Dovetail

Dovetail is built specifically for qualitative research. You can upload session recordings, transcripts, and survey responses. The AI tags themes, identifies patterns, and generates summaries across multiple sources.
While testing a healthcare CRM last year, our team analysed and reviewed 14 hours of user sessions. We use the tool and reduce analysis time of initial design work by around 60% and spotted confusing data entry steps as the app’s main pain point.
Pricing: Basic plan from $29/month. Team plan from $99/month. Free trial available.
What it doesn’t do well: The AI summaries are a starting point, not a final analysis. They miss nuance, particularly around emotional tone and the context behind what a user said. Always read the actual transcripts before presenting findings.
Hotjar AI

Hotjar’s AI feature reads session recordings and heatmaps and writes plain-English summaries of what it finds. For example: ‘Users are repeatedly clicking the export button but the file download is not triggering. 12 sessions in the last 7 days show this pattern.’
The tool scans user recordings to learn about behavior and save around two to three hours every week. It mainly finds information about major friction points which can later guide team to focus its manual reviews on the most critical sessions.
Pricing: Included in Hotjar Business ($99/month) and Scale plans.
Phase 2- AI tools for information architecture and wireframing
Most AI hype is fake because the software is only good for starting a project. It is not completely reliable as AI tools cannot figure out the best structure to make a product easy to use.
The right way to use AI is to generate 3 to 4 rough layouts in 20 minutes to beat the blank page, and then manually evaluate which one works best.
Relume

Relume generates functional sitemaps and wireframe structures of the digital product directly inside Figma from a basic text description. It maps out page hierarchies and rough content blocks instantly. This way the tool eliminates the blank-canvas phase and speed up early layout setup.
On projects where we need to quickly map out a large information architecture before a client workshop, it cuts the prep time roughly in half. We then revise heavily based on what we know about the actual users.
Pricing: Free plan available. Pro: $38/month.
What it doesn’t do well: Default structures tend to look like every other SaaS product. If you need something genuinely novel, Relume gets you to a starting point but it won’t get you to a differentiated navigation model.
Uizard

Uizard converts text prompts, sketches, or screenshots into clickable prototypes. You can either describe a screen and it generates a layout, or you hand-draw a rough sketch, photograph it, and upload it.
While the output isn’t production-ready, it provides just enough interactive fidelity to test core navigation choices and secure fast stakeholder sign-off under tight deadlines.
Pricing: Free starter plan. Pro: $12/month. Team: $20/user/month.
Google Stitch

Google Stitch (formerly Galileo AI) generates UI layouts from simple text or voice prompts. The latest 2.0 update allows you to map out up to five connected screens simultaneously on an infinite canvas and voice input.
The best way to use the tool is to test early wireframe layouts. You can prompt it to make a few options, pick the best layout, and send it to Figma. It takes a 5-screen onboarding flow from a half day of sketching to 30 minutes of work.
It’s particularly fast at generating form layouts, dashboard structures, and multi-step onboarding flows.
Pricing: You can use Google Stitch for free via Google Labs. Get 350 standard and Gemini 2.5 Flash plus 200 Pro generations every month with no credit card needed. Paid plans arrive in late 2026- by fourth quarter.
Geographic availability: Regional restrictions currently block access in Spain, the UAE, and Eastern Europe.
What it doesn’t do well: Defaults strongly to Material Design 3 aesthetics. Products needing a distinct visual language require significant rework after generation. As a Labs experiment, long-term access and feature availability are not guaranteed.
Phase 3- AI tools for visual UI design
This is where AI tools are most polarizing. The concern that AI replaces designers is loudest here. In our experience, that concern is premature for anything above surface-level design work.
Figma AI

Figma’s built-in tools now handle everything from asset searching to automated screen creation. In daily work, the contextual copy generator is the most practical tool that gives you instant, realistic form text.
On the other hand, while Figma Make quickly drafts full layout concepts, the results are rarely production-ready. You will still need to do significant cleanup before sharing these screens with stakeholders.
Pricing: Figma Starter: Free. Professional: $15/editor/month. Organization: $45/editor/month.
UXPin Forge

UXPin Forge generates UI layouts using your actual React component library rather than generic design patterns. That distinction matters in practice. When an AI tool generates from generic templates, the output needs hours of rework to align with your existing design system, brand, and engineering requirements. When it is generated from your real components, the output is often usable within the same session.
Teams using Forge with Merge report up to 8.6x faster design-to-prototype cycles when AI handles the initial layout structure and a designer refines from there. For client projects where we’re working within an established design system, Forge cuts the time between brief and reviewable prototype significantly.

Pricing: around $19/month (for starter pack). Advanced: $39/month. Enterprise plans available. Free trial included.
What it doesn’t do well: The component-library approach means it’s only as good as your design system. If your Figma file is disorganised, tokens are inconsistent, or components aren’t properly named, Forge produces inconsistent output. Getting the most from this tool requires a solid design system foundation first.
Phase 4- AI tools for usability testing
Testing is where AI has made the most concrete impact on our workflow. Specifically, it speeds up analysis, not the testing itself. You still need real users completing real tasks.
Maze

With Maze, you can simply connect a Figma prototype and let participants run through tasks on their own time. The platform automatically flags user hesitation, friction points, and completion rates, then groups the findings for you. This cuts our post-test analysis timeline from four hours down to less than one. Because the software handles the initial data grouping, we skip the tedious cleanup phase entirely and focus our expertise on explaining the “why.”
Maze also integrates directly with Figma, so the prototype connection is direct. For a comparison of testing approaches and when each applies, see our guide on usability testing methods.
Pricing: Free plan (limited tests). Pro: $99/month. Organization plans available.
Attention Insight
Attention Insight uses AI to predict where users will look on a screen before any real user sees it. You upload a design and it generates a predicted attention heatmap based on trained models from eye-tracking studies.
It’s a useful tool for pre-validation stage. It ensures your key buttons and hero sections are actually drawing the eye and follows the right visual hierarchy. The concept doesn’t replace live usability testing but it can spot issues in the site layout before you spend time on prototyping process.
Pricing: around $29/month (for basic) and $99/month (for pro package).

Phase 5- AI tools for design handoff and documentation
Handoff documentation is a slow, unglamorous part of UX work. It takes real effort to properly explain designs and layouts so developers can code without constant interruptions.
Zeroheight

Zeroheight is a design system documentation tool with AI features for generating component descriptions, writing usage guidelines, and flagging incomplete documentation. It connects to Figma and automatically pulls in component data.
For large-scale SaaS products, this workflow cuts documentation time by about 40%. The AI copy still requires some editing but you can use it for initial work and save a lot of your time.
Pricing: It is free for the starter pack. For Team: $149/month. Enterprise plans available.
Supernova

Supernova takes a Figma design system and converts it to working code tokens and component documentation. The AI feature handles token naming, generates code-ready values, and writes initial developer notes.
By closing this technical gap, the tool completely removes the need for constant design-to-dev handoff sessions. It is highly recommended for keeping your live production environment perfectly synced with your design files.
Pricing: The starter plan runs at $15 per month and it is around $25/editor per month.

What doesn’t actually hold up in practice
Every article on AI tools tells you what works. Here’s what we’ve found disappointing in real project conditions.
Prompt-to-full-product tools for complex SaaS
AI product generators look good superficially but often fail on complex workflows and data structures. For example- you might see critical states missing (empty states, error states, loading) and navigation that does not account for real user roles.
You can use them for stakeholder presentations, but not recommended for direct development.
AI tools for accessibility checks
Many reports suggest that automation tools catch around 30% of WCAG issues which are basically related to the accessibility standards. You can trust these tools to get quick layout inspiration, but human oversight is non-negotiable if you want functional, compliant design ideas.
Color contrast checks and missing alt text get caught reliably. Cognitive load, confusing navigation, poor focus management, and keyboard traps generally do not.
Run automated checks, but also do manual testing and testing with assistive technology. The automated pass is not an accessibility pass.
AI for user interview moderation
AI systems can now interview users without any human moderator. Although the output answers look very structured or sound robotic, the chats can sometimes miss the follow-up questions that provide the most valuable details. A human researcher will always ask more about surprising answers, whereas the AI just blindly follows its list.
Use AI for analysis after interviews. Not instead of a human conducting them.
How should your team decide which tools to use?
The most practical framework is to start with your biggest time sink, not the most hyped tool.
If research synthesis is taking your team two days per project, start with ChatGPT and Dovetail. If you’re losing time to wireframe iteration and stakeholder review cycles, try Relume and Uizard. If handoff is creating constant back-and-forth with developers, look at Zeroheight.
A few things worth checking before committing to any paid tool:
- Does it integrate with Figma? If your team’s master files are in Figma, a tool that requires you to export, reformat, and re-import adds more time than it saves.
- Who owns the data? For healthcare and financial products, check carefully whether uploaded designs or user data are used for training or stored beyond your session.
- Does it have an honest free trial? Most of these tools have a free tier or a proper trial. Test it on a real task from your workflow, not the curated demo. If it doesn’t hold up on real work, it won’t hold up at 11pm before a client presentation.

Can AI tools replace UX designers?
Not for work that requires real user understanding. AI tools speed up specific tasks: writing documentation, generating layout variations, synthesizing research notes. They cannot conduct meaningful user interviews, make informed decisions about what a confused user actually needs, or diagnose whether a product’s core information architecture is right. Those decisions require a trained designer with context.
